Seen a few post on here now about diffrent types of cod like poor cod and tommy cod.how many types is there and how do u tell them apart?
 
Only one cod . I think a tommy is a very small codling. A codling is a few pound . And a cod is a big fish double figures. There are differnt color cod u get the normal cod colour and red cod that are from kelp beds. :)

Cod/ pouting/poor cod are all different species.
Codling, tommy cod are local /slang names for cod.
Scotch haddock (scotchie) are local /slang names for a pouting
 
Cod are all one specie. A tommy is a cod that is under the legal size limit of 35cm. A codling is a cod upto 7lb i.e if it is 6lb 12oz its a codling if it is 7lb 1oz then its a cod. A poor cod is a cross breed of the cod and a pouting and is a different specie so would count in your specie hunt the record is only 11oz. A Pout/pouting is a different species also but has many localised names north of the Tyne tends to be a scotch haddock or scotchie, travel to Seaham and they are called Blegs.
